#878ef8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#878ef8 is composed of 52.9% red, 55.7%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.6% cyan, 42.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 236.3 degrees, a saturation of 89% and a lightness of 75.1%. #878ef8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#0f1df1.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

#878ef8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#878ef8 has RGB values of R:135, G:142, B:248 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 8883960.

Shades and Tints of #878ef8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01010a is the darkest color, while #f6f7fe is the lightest one.
